This board book version of Ada Lovelace - an international bestseller from the beloved Little People, BIG DREAMS series - introduces the youngest dreamers to the world's first computer programmer. As a child, Adahad a big imagination and a talent for mathematics. She grew up in a noble household in England, where she dedicated herself to studying. Her work with the famous inventor, Charles Babbage, on a very early kind of computer made her the world's first computer programmer.
